I know a ton of people run these, so if you use something other than the usual sponge/carbon/bio or sponge/sponge/bio combinations, speak up. Let's keep this to AQUACLEAR HOB's ONLY! Nothing theoretical please, just what you have personally seen work well. Also, let us know what size AC you are talking about & list media from bottom to top. I'll go first!

AC70
AC sponge/Rena SuperMicro 2-stage pad/polishing floss/Biomax bag

AC50 (w/ AC sponge prefilter)
AC sponge/Rena SuperMicro pad/AC70 Biomax bag

i use dacron sheets on the bottom of my hob. then i have a carbon bag then i have some bioballs and then a biowheel
 
I don't use the standard media except for the ceramic rings.

I only have 110:
first: filter floss ( very fine )
Second: 2" coarse filter mesh
3rd: Ceramic rings
4th: carbon
5th: 1" wide, 2" tall coarse filter mesh to catch anything before water fall

I need to get more mechanical media so next water change ( 3 weeks or so due to cycling ) i will add more mechanical to both of my 110s.
 
bio then spongs then pollyfill mating. i run the sponge after the media it seems to put it more directly in the water flow seems to help with bypass
